I agree with confused. You have to reward yourself for doing good.

Making small goals and sticking to them helps you to be able to reach bigger goals. I think the bigger goal is the control of your emotions in a negative situation. A smaller goal would be something like "The next time I hear bad news, I'm going to take a deep breath and count to ten."

Or if you have trouble cleaning then it's better to do a small goal. "Today I will wash my clothes. Tomorrow I will put them away." Etc.

You are not alone. The other day I had a total tantrum because I spilled a soda.
Not a proud moment, but definately a bipolar one....
